性能分析
海蜘蛛er
这个作者很懒,什么都没留下…
展开
-
Linux对机器进行性能分析之网络篇
文章目录前言pingifconfig后记前言比较宽泛地讲,网络方向的性能分析既包括主机测的网络配置查看、监控,又包括网络链路上的包转发时延、吞吐量、带宽等指标分析。pingping 发送 ICMP echo 数据包来探测网络的连通性,除了能直观地看出网络的连通状况外,还能获得本次连接的往返时间(RTT 时间),丢包情况,以及访问的域名所对应的 IP 地址(使用 DNS 域名解析),比如:我们 ping baidu.com,-c参数指定发包数。可以看到,解析到了 baidu 的一台服务器 IP 地址原创 2020-08-04 13:34:34 · 844 阅读 · 0 评论 -
Linux对机器进行性能分析之IO篇
文章目录前言磁盘基本信息fdiskdf磁盘性能分析vmstatiostat进程IO性能分析iotop后记前言IO 和 存储密切相关,存储可以概括为磁盘,内存,缓存,三者读写的性能差距非常大,磁盘读写是毫秒级的(一般 0.1-10ms),内存读写是微妙级的(一般0.1-10us),cache 是纳秒级的(一般 1-10ns)。但这也是牺牲其他特性为代价的,速度快的,价格越贵,容量也越小。IO 性能这块,我们更多关注的是读写磁盘的性能。首先,先了解下磁盘的基本信息。磁盘基本信息fdisk查看磁盘信原创 2020-08-03 14:19:29 · 1299 阅读 · 0 评论 -
Linux对机器进行性能分析之内存篇
文章目录前言内存信息/proc/meminfofreedmidecodevmstat进程内存使用情况分析pspmap后记前言前面我们已经学习了 CPU 篇,这篇来看下内存篇。内存信息/proc/meminfo这个文件记录着比较详细的内存配置信息,使用 cat /proc/meminfo 查看。[root@master ~]# cat /proc/meminfoMemTotal: 1863196 kB系统总内存,由于 BIOS、内核等会占用一些内存,所以这里和配置声称的内存会有一原创 2020-08-03 11:20:32 · 860 阅读 · 0 评论 -
Linux对机器进行性能分析之CPU篇
前言平常工作会涉及到一些 Linux 性能分析的问题,因此决定总结一下常用的一些性能分析手段,仅供参考。说到性能分析,基本上就是 CPU、内存、磁盘 IO 以及网络这几个部分。已经整理过很多次了但还有地方不熟练,多练习多总结对比!性能分析之CPU篇进行性能分析之前,首先得知道 CPU 有哪些信息,可以通过以下方法查看 CPU配置信息。lscpu在 Linux 下,类似 lsxxx 这样的命令都是用来查看基本信息的,如 ls 查看当前目录文件信息,lscpu 就用来查看 CPU 信息,类似还有原创 2020-08-03 10:28:56 · 1635 阅读 · 0 评论